What Does "Low-Friction, High-Response" Mean in a Human Life?
In interactions with real people, friction is everywhere, and most of it comes in very small forms. You ask a teacher a question; they explain it twice and you still don't get it, and on the third try their tone shifts — maybe just a half-second pause, maybe just an added "Does that make sense now?" You pour your heart out to a friend, and the friend says, "You told me this last time." You argue with your parents, and they say, "Never mind — you'll understand when you're older," and change the subject. You and your partner fall into a cold standoff, and your partner goes silent, says "You're not even listening," and turns to do something else. You ask a coworker for help, and they say, "Let's talk about this another day" — and that other day may never come.
All of these are friction. What they share is this: the other person is sending you a message about themselves. They are tired. They have run out of patience. They disagree. They have other things to do. They feel you are wasting their time. They don't want to keep going with this topic. They have feelings about you. They have a world you cannot enter, or a state of mind you cannot reach in that moment.
AI does refuse, of course, but usually only when a safety rule is triggered. And that kind of refusal is rarely because it is tired, or hurt, or doesn't feel like dealing with you, or has a life of its own. Its refusals come from rules, not from a self that has to be respected. Ask it the same question for the tenth time and its tone is the same as the first. Lose your temper with it yesterday and it is just as gentle today. Push back even slightly and it yields at once — sometimes even supplying reasons on your behalf. It doesn't get tired, annoyed, wounded, or disappointed; it holds no grudges; and it never needs you to look after its feelings. It has no "another day," because for it, it is always today, always now.
That is what low friction means: not that the interaction is free of obstacles, but that the resistance coming from the other party's own selfhood has been systematically removed.
Human responsiveness is finite. When class ends, a teacher has a life too; sometimes they can stay behind to help you, and sometimes something comes up and they leave. Friends have their own lives and families; parents grow old, may fall ill, and may in the end leave before you do. And even when they are present, human responses can be rough: once is fine, twice more is fine, but if you still don't understand after that, that's your problem. In theory, even a person willing to explain again and again so that you understand is ultimately bounded by time, energy, and emotion.
AI responds in an entirely different way. If you don't understand, it rephrases. Still don't, it tries another angle. Still don't, it gives an example. Still don't, it breaks things into smaller steps, uses simpler words, draws up a table, offers an analogy. It will circle the same concept with you twenty times, reorganizing its language each time, without a single trace of "how can you be this slow?" It fills in what you didn't think to ask, notices where you are stuck, and adjusts length, difficulty, tone, and pacing to fit you.
That is what high response means: not that it answers a lot, but that it is willing to rearrange itself endlessly, until you are comfortable.
Put the two together and you notice something strange: this combination almost never exists in human relationships. You can find a very patient teacher, but they get tired too. You can find a partner who loves you deeply, but they will still say no to you. You can find a friend willing to go around in circles with you, but by the third lap they will say, "Should we grab a coffee first?"
AI is the first thing to push both to the extreme at the same time. And precisely because it does both at once, it is very hard for us to notice what we are losing.
When Friction Disappears, What Else Disappears
Friction matters not simply because it makes us uncomfortable, but because it performs three functions at once.
First: friction is a signal of boundaries. When someone says "no," they are telling you: I am not an extension of you. What makes a person "them" — a separate person at all — lies largely in the fact that I cannot fully configure them. They have their own place, and the right not to reshape themselves according to my needs.
Second: friction is cognitive training. Empathy grows out of the pain of still trying to understand someone after being misunderstood by them. Resilience is ground out over the days when, after a conflict, you can still sit down and share a meal. Judgment awakens in the moment when, told by authority to obey, you learn to ask "why?" and "by what right?" Not one of these capacities is born from comfort.
Third: friction is a calibration against reality. When you believe your reasons are solid and the other person still says "no," you are forced to re-examine those reasons. The process is uncomfortable — yet, uncomfortable as it is, it is one of the key mechanisms by which we come to notice "I might be wrong."
A low-friction, high-response environment cancels all three functions at once. And it cancels them in the gentlest possible way — it doesn't argue with you; it simply stops giving you those signals.
The problem is that AI's compliance is not neutral. A Stanford study I came across, published in Science as "Sycophantic AI decreases prosocial intentions and promotes dependence," found that mainstream AI models affirm users' actions 49% more often than humans do (a preprint figure; the final version describes the models as "nearly 50% more sycophantic"), and that even when users are plainly involved in deception, illegal conduct, or wrongdoing in their relationships, the models still side with them 51% of the time. More worrying still, users cannot tell when AI flattery is flattery: they rate sycophantic and non-sycophantic AI as equally "objective" — yet when asked which they prefer, they choose the sycophantic one.
REF: https://pubmed.ncbi.nlm.nih.gov/41886588/
This means we are not only interacting with a compliant system; we are systematically preferring the compliance itself. And that preference is quietly reshaping us.
The Hidden Turn in Cognitive Outsourcing: From "Looking It Up" to "Handing Over Judgment"
Cognitive outsourcing, put simply, means handing the mental work we were once responsible for — thinking, remembering, judging — to an external tool or system. From counting on our fingers to relying on GPS, humans have always done this. But generative AI brings a change in kind: we no longer outsource only retrieval or routine operations; we have begun to outsource judgment itself. A prompt replaces a question; a block of generated text replaces an argument. The danger is that this is hard to notice: once AI becomes the default, offloading cognition doesn't feel like a loss — it feels like a gain in efficiency. When we use AI to help us write, for instance, activity in the frontal regions tied to executive function may drop, and memory retention and originality may decline with it. Over time, might the brain lose some of its creativity, its capacity for reflection, or other abilities besides? What gets outsourced is precisely the ability to "turn information into understanding." After GPS, our sense of direction declined; after smartphones, many people no longer memorize phone numbers; after calculators, many people can no longer do basic arithmetic. I see this as a degradation — or a surrender — of ability brought on by a qualitative kind of dependence.
The Cognitive Mechanics of Sycophancy: Why "Knowing It Flatters You" Won't Protect You
AI's compliance is not an accidental design flaw; it stems from a structural feature of how these systems are trained. AI is trained to produce "answers that human raters like," and human preference judgments are themselves biased toward pleasing responses. That makes sycophancy a tendency rooted at the architectural level — one that even the most advanced models struggle to eliminate.
The most unsettling thing about this mechanism is that it doesn't need to say anything false to have an effect. For the small number of users who are in a psychologically vulnerable state, this constant affirmation can even develop into what researchers call a "delusional spiral": the user puts forward paranoid, grandiose, or reality-detached ideas, and the chatbot responds with care, validation, and further elaboration of the narrative, so that the two form an ever more closed feedback loop. The user's confidence in a false belief grows over time, eventually reaching the point where they may act on it.
More critically, even explicitly telling users that a chatbot may be prone to sycophancy does not protect them from its influence. This means individual vigilance is not enough to withstand the slow erosion of a structural cognitive vulnerability. When the erosion works faster than reflective awareness can detect it, cognitive integrity cannot be maintained by the vigilance the mind naturally possesses alone. Similar psychological mechanisms appear in manipulative relationships, scams, and extremist groups: through constant affirmation, isolation from dissenting views, and the cultivation of dependence, they gradually weaken a person's ability to test their own beliefs. AI may have no intent to manipulate, yet in the absence of outside friction it can produce a similar structural effect.
This is the real predicament we face. We are used to imagining AI's risks as "will it give me wrong information?" or "is it hallucinating a wrong answer?" But the more dangerous risk is "will it make us feel we have been right all along?" It is like a ruler surrounded by nothing but eunuchs and palace maids, fawning and toadying all day, their endless yes-saying clouding the ruler's judgment — no criticism, no reckoning, only agreement. However capable that ruler is, their judgment will be gradually eroded by the people around them. In the same way, people who form a strong attachment to AI may very well have their judgment eroded by it, and drift further and further from the relationships in their real lives.
